Hunting Grounds[1] (formerly known as "Howl" after theAllen Ginsberg poem of the same name[2]) are a six piece Australian punk band. They formed atBallarat High School[3] and wonTriple J's Unearthed High competition[4] with their song "Blackout"[5] which was placed on high rotation by the station.[6]
In 2010 Hunting Grounds supported fellow Ballarat actYacht Club DJs on their Batten Down the Hatches Australian Tour. The tour was sold out and the two bands fronted two encore shows atSt Kilda's Prince of Wales Bandroom.
